## Runbook: Sort stability in Quillboard

Reports built in Quillboard must sort deterministically. The builder applies a secondary sort on row ID whenever the primary key has ties; if users report rows shuffling between runs, verify the stable-sort flag is on before anything else. Never toggle it mid-render. Check the flag against the service's current configuration, shown here.

service settings:
PRAIX_LOG_LEVEL=error
PRAIX_METRICS_HOST=metrics.praix.qorvelcorp.corp
PRAIX_POOL_SIZE=16

**Ticket: Config drift on rotatorд staging — sorry, Rotomatic staging**

Hey on-call — Rotomatic (our secrets-rotation utility) is behaving differently on staging vs prod again. Rotation interval on staging looks like someone hand-edited it after the Pellworth incident and never synced it back. Nothing's on fire, but next rotation window could skip two vaults. Can you reconcile before Thursday's run? For reference, here's what staging is actually running with right now.

deployment values, kajep-kageg:
[praix]
host = praix.paliqcorp.corp
user = praix_svc
database = praix_prod

## FAQ: What if SpoolHaven fails mid-release?

If the SpoolHaven printer-spooler microservice becomes unresponsive during a rollout, first check whether the job-intake queue is draining; a stalled queue usually indicates the render workers lost their lease. Do not restart the whole pod set, as in-flight print jobs will be lost. Instead, trigger the supervised failover from the Quarrow console, which replays queued jobs safely. The console will require the emergency recovery credential, which is the passphrase below.

vault phrase of kawep-tahog = ulaix-briath

## ORM Refactor: Plugin Compatibility

The legacy Stonebridge ORM is being split into a query core and an adapter shim. Plugins must target the shim only; direct session access will be removed next release. Lazy-load behavior changes: collections now hydrate in fixed-size pages. Plugins that override fetch strategy must respect the new limits, enumerated here.

constants for bawep-fajog:
RATE_LIMITS = {
    "oliath": 2,
    "wenix": 5,
    "quenael": 5,
    "ralix": 2,
}